A Helicopter Control based on Eigenstructure Assignment [PDF]

open access: yes2006 IEEE Conference on Emerging Technologies and Factory Automation, 2006
In this paper a controller based in the eigenvalues assignment technique is designed. Pie system to be stabilized is an unmanned helicopter. This eigenstructure based controller is designed considering all the measurable states. A LQ controller has also been applied to the same system in order to compare the responses regarding the robustness.

The Eigenstructure of the Bernstein Operator

open access: yesJournal of Approximation Theory, 2000
The authors determine the eigenvalues and eigenfunctions of the Bernstein operator \(B_n\), the latter are, of course, \(n+1\) polynomials of degrees \(k=0,\dots,n\). They show that the \(k\)th eigen-polynomial \(p^{(n)}_k\) has \(k\) simple zeros in \([0,1]\) and describe \(\lim_{n\to\infty}p^{(n)}_k\), for fixed \(k\).
